I have a new app. It's called Zombies; Run!
The premise is that you've survived the zombie apocalypse and are now heading towards the safe zone. But the helicopter's been shot down by a surprise rpg attack and the only thing left to do is run back to safety.
Along the way you're directed to pick up useful things - because as the nasty lady says - people have to pull their weight or they won't be lit into the safe zone. The nice chap was in love with your predecessor - it'll be interesting to see how that plays out
It's an ongoing tale of everyday zombie adventures
